April 29 Spring Into Sidesaddle Clinic at American Dream Farm




Georgia Ladies Aside was invited to give a sidesaddle clinic at the beautiful American Dream Farm, in Statham, GA. There were six youth riders and two adult riders. We started the clinic with saddle fitting the four horses that were going to be ridden. Then we had a sidesaddle chat on history, attire, and saddles. Then it was out to the arena to ride. Some of the riders walked, trotted and cantered! One of the adult riders said that sidesaddle riding had been on her bucket list. She can mark that off as she was one of the riders who cantered. The riders had fun switching horses to try out the different saddles. The Steele English Pleasure received the most votes for the favorite saddle to ride in. After riding we had a small fashion show and photo shoot. Thank you American Dream Farm for inviting us to give this clinic. The farm is gorgeous, your horses well-trained and lovely and all of the ladies were so much fun to teach. It was a fun filled day with a lot of laughs and smiles. March 10 American Sidesaddle Association’s Annual Award Banquet
The American Sidesaddle Association’s Annual Award Banquet was held in Burlington, North Carolina. There was a side saddle fitting clinic, lunch, and a tour of the Hundred Oaks side saddlery. At the banquet we had a costume contest.
Congratulations to the following Georgia Ladies Aside members Lisa Doker, Duffie Yarbrough, Steve, Stephanie and Romeo Hutcherson who all won year end awards in many different categories. Georgia Ladies Aside won the Busy Bee Award. The award is for the ASA regional group who participated in the most events.

Oct 1-2 Side Saddle Weekend 2011
Georgia Ladies Aside member Stephanie and her horse, Romeo were honored once again to participate in Side Saddle Weekend at the Kentucky Horse Park in Lexington, KY. Stephanie and Romeo showed the horse park visitors how you jump in a side saddle. Other side saddle riders from across the United States demonstrated riding dressage and gaited horses. July 14 Ride Aside at Sonora Creek Farm
On July 14, members of the Sonora Creek Middle and High School Interscholastic Equestrian Teams had an afternoon of sidesaddle fun at Sonora Creek Farm in Canton, GA. Georgia Ladies Aside member Stephanie gave a small talk on sidesaddle, and then a demonstration ride before the girls gave it a try. Only two of the girls had ridden sidesaddle before. Some of the girls rode at all three gaits, and all but one walked and trotted. Everyone had a great time. Thanks to our wonderful sidesaddle mounts, Romeo and Guinness. What a fun day! Ride Aside!
